ISpTaskManager::CreateThreadControl (Windows CE 5.0)

Send Feedback

This method allocates a thread control object, but does not allocate a thread.

HRESULT CreateThreadControl(ISpThreadTask* pTask,void* pvTaskData,long nPriority,ISpThreadControl** ppThreadCtrl);

Parameters

  • pTask
    [in] Pointer to an object implementing ISpThreadTask that is used to initialize and execute the task thread.
  • pvTaskData
    [in] Pointer to data that will be passed to all ISpThreadTask methods. This value can be NULL.
  • nPriority
    [in] Win32 priority for the allocated thread.
  • ppThreadCtrl
    [out] Address of a pointer to an object implementing ISpThreadControl that represents the thread control.

Return Values

The following table shows the possible return values.

Value Description
S_OK Function completed successfully.
E_INVALIDARG pTask is invalid or bad.
E_POINTER ppThreadCtrl is invalid or bad.
E_OUTOFMEMORY Exceeded available memory.
FAILED(hr) Appropriate error message.

Requirements

OS Versions: Windows CE .NET 4.1 and later.
Header: Sapiddk.h, Sapiddk.idl.
Link Library: Sapilib.lib.
